Consumer Financial Protection Bureau drops lawsuits against Capital One and Berkshire, Rocket Cos. units

Source: CNBC

“The Consumer Financial Protection Bureau’s new leadership on Thursday dismissed at least four enforcement lawsuits undertaken by the previous administration’s director. In legal filings, the CFPB issued a notice of voluntary dismissal for cases involving Capital One; Berkshire Hathaway-owned Vanderbilt Mortgage & Finance; a Rocket Cos. unit called Rocket Homes Real Estate; and a loan servicer named Pennsylvania Higher Education Assistance Agency. … In conjunction with Elon Musk’s Department of Government Efficiency, the CFPB has shuttered its Washington headquarters, fired about 200 employees and told those who remain to stop nearly all work.” (02/27/25)
